My washer will not stop filling up during the last rinse and spin cycle, it overflows into the floor. What could be the problem

Overfilling is commonly caused by a blockage in the pressure chamber, it could also be a faulty pressure switch (less common). A hole in the pressure chamber tube between pressure chamber and pressure switch can cause overfilling. Pressure system faults can be tricky to solve. You need qualified assistance.
